Virginia has agreed to a three-game football series with Coastal Carolina beginning in November of 2022 in Charlottesville. It is a two-for-one deal, with the Cavaliers set to play Coastal in Myrtle Beach in 2024 before the final game of the series returns to Scott Stadium in August of 2025.
